Triple Talaq has no place in a secular country: Centre tells Supreme Court

October 8, 2016

New Delhi, Oct 8: The Centre on Friday opposed before the Supreme Court the practice of triple talaq, saying anything that is subjected to the whims of menfolk was incompatible with the principle of gender equality and justice as enshrined in the Constitution.

talaq“Gender justice and dignity of women are non-negotiable and overarching constitutional values, and can brook no compromise in a secular country like India,” the government stated. In an affidavit, the NDA government contended that triple talaq, nikah halala' (bar against remarriage with divorced husband, without an intervening marriage with another man) and polygamy cannot be regarded as an integral part of the religion.

“Even theocratic countries where Islam is a state religion have undergone reforms, so these practices cannot be regarded as integral to the religion and India being a secular republic, there is no reason to deny the women rights available under the Constitution,” the law ministry said.

Coming out in support of a batch of petitions, including one by advocate Balaji Srinivasan on behalf of Shayara Bano, the government said the issue of the validity of triple talaq, nikah halala' and polygamy needs to be considered in the light of principles of gender justice and overriding constitutional principles of non-discrimination, dignity and equality.

The Centre stated: “Secularism being a hallmark of Indian democracy, no part of its citizenry ought to be denied access to fundamental rights, much less can a section of secular society be worse off than its counterparts in theocratic countries, many of which have undergone reforms.”

The Centre said though polygamy was regarded progressive and path-breaking centuries ago, in light of the principle of gender justice, it required “serious reconsideration”.

Triple talaq, nikah halala' and polygamy cannot be regarded as essential and integral part of the religion and would therefore be not entitled to protection under Article 25 (right to practice religion) of the Constitution, it added.

Even an affidavit by the Muslim Personal Law Board has referred to those practices as “undesirable” and which cannot be elevated to essential religious practice, the government said.

“Personal laws must be examined in the light of the overarching goal of gender justice and dignity of women... Any provision of the personal law which is inconsistent with fundamental rights is void,” the government said. Can personal laws, meant to preserve diverse identity, be used as a pretext to deny women equality and status available under the Constitution, the Centre asked

Mangaluru, Feb 18: Customs at International Airport here have seized Rs 58.95 lakh worth gold in two incidents and arrested two smugglers, Customs Commissionerate said on Monday.

According to the department, two men have been arrested by the customs officials in two separate incidents last evening for attempting to smuggle gold into the country valuing over Rs. 58.95 Lakhs.

In the first incident, Muhammed Swalih Chappathodi, 22, hailing from Malappuram, Kerala who arrived from Dubai by Spice jet flight concealed capsules containing gold in paste form inside his rectum which upon purification resulted in the recovery of 797 gm of 24 karats valued at Rs.32,35,820.

Mangaluru, Apr 4: Dakshina Kannada district deputy commissioner (DC) Sindhu B Rupesh in an official reminder has ordered milk unions to disburse about 5,000 litres of milk to residents of notified and non-notified slums, construction labourers and migrant labourers and their families in shelters in the district.

A decision regarding the free distribution of milk to such needy families was taken in a meeting by the chief minister on April 1.

The DC has ordered cooperative milk unions in the district to distribute milk to such families from April 4 till April 14.

Bengaluru, Apr 25: With 26 new COVID-19 cases confirmed in the past 24 hours, the total number of positive cases in Karnataka reached 500 on Saturday.

This includes 158 patients who have been cured and discharged following treatment while 18 deaths have been reported so far due to the infection in the State, according to a media bulletin issued by the Department of Health and Family Welfare on Saturday evening.

A total of 324 COVID-19 cases are currently active in the State as of Saturday evening 5 pm.
According to the bulletin, Bengaluru Urban with 133 positive cases, including 49 discharged and four deaths, is the worst-affected district in the State, followed by Mysuru and Belagavi, with 89 and 54 confirmed cases, respectively.
